  • Original language name

    Numerical computation of cutoff frequency of irregular hexagonal waveguide

  • Original language description

    This paper deals with numerical computations of cutoff frequencies of various crosssection waveguides including irregular hexagonal waveguide. Simulation results are very important for assembling of ventilation structures, which are used as a highly effective electromagnetic shielding. There is shown a lot of results for different size of waveguides. Numerical models were solved by finite element method (FEM).
